The MLB regular season is over. Time for the baseball version of “Bloody Monday”.

Rocco Baldelli out as manager of the Minnesota Twins. 70-92 this season.

Baldelli finished his seven-season tenure with a 527-505 record (.511 win percentage). The only Twins managers with more victories are Tom Kelly (1,140-1,244) and Ron Gardenhire (1,068-1,039).

Bob Melvin out as manager of the San Francisco Giants.

Under Melvin, the Giants went 80-82 last year and 81-81 this season, which wa president of baseball operations Buster Posey’s first in his new position.

In 22 seasons, Melvin has a 1,678-1,588 record with the Mariners, Diamondbacks, A’s, Padres and Giants.

He was 161-163 in two seasons with San Francisco.
